Heavy rains cause serious flooding in Lao Cai
Heavy rain early on Monday morning has caused serious flooding in many areas in the northern province of Lao Cai. 
According to local authorities, up to 117 mm of rain overloaded local drainage systems.
Many families have reported flood water of some 15-35 centimetres inside their houses. 
Many roads and streets in the area have also been put under water. Le Thanh Street experienced 80 centimetres of water. Other streets including Tran Hung Dao, Vo Nguyen Giap, Tran Phu were also submerged which caused congestion during morning rush hours.  ....

Africa's last absolute monarch faces push for democracy as unrest rocks Eswatini


Africa’s last absolute monarch faces push for democracy as unrest rocks Eswatini
Stéphanie TROUILLARD
© Pius Utomi Ekpei, AFP
The landlocked and impoverished kingdom of Eswatini, formerly known as Swaziland, has been rocked by days of violent clashes between security forces and demonstrators calling for democratic reforms. Amid the mounting unrest, the government has denied reports that King Mswati III fled the violence to neighbouring South Africa.
Has Africa’s last absolute monarch gone into hiding? 
Mswati III, Eswatini’s longtime ruler known for his extravagant lifestyle, is facing some of the biggest protests of his 35-year reign – but his whereabouts are in dispute. His opponents claim the king slipped out of the country on board his private jet on Monday as protests took a violent turn.
